Bassist Ira Trevisan Leaves CSS
Band readies new album for July release
Photo by Nilina Mason-Campbell
CSS, you always know what to say. In what sounds like one of the most amicable departures in the history of these things, bassist Ira Trevisan has left the Brazilian electro-punk troupe due to what they're calling "personal reasons."
Ira explains her move in a statement posted on the band's MySpace blog: "I decided to move forward and dedicate more of my time to fashion and other projects. Just a big change of priorities, as I will never stop playing music. I am also a bit worried about climate change. People should care more and do something about it. I decided to fly less. CSS will always be in my heart. They said goodbye to their bass player, but they won a new life time fan. In health and sickness, in happiness and so forth. Blah blah blah, so help us God." See? Funny! Not sad! Well played, ya'll.
With Trevisan's exit, drummer Adriano Cintra will pick up the bass, and a session drummer (a CSS chum, it's claimed) will join the group in the live setting. What, no reality television auditions?
The band also took the opportunity to fill in a few details on their forthcoming LP. Well, just one detail, really: it'll hit the UK in July. More info is expected to follow soon, since, hey, July ain't so far off. For now, though, there's quite a little tour in the works, which kicks off May 5 in Cardiff.
